2010-01-01から1年間の記事一覧

SymfonyEventDispatcher→Symfony2(PR4)EventDispatcherの変更点

この記事は、Symfony アドベントカレンダー 2010 に参加しています。Symfony Advent 2010 : ATND http://www.symfony.gr.jp/adventcalendar/2010 前の記事 先日、Observerパターンから学ぶSymfonyEventDispatcherの実装というエントリでsymfony1.4でのEventD…

symfonyでデータベースの接続情報を扱う

symfonyでデータベースを利用する際、config/databases.ymlに以下のように接続設定を記述します。 all: # 環境 doctrine: # 設定名 class: sfDoctrineDatabase # 接続クラス param: # パラメータ dsn: mysql:host=localhost;dbname=hoge username: root pass…

Observerパターンから学ぶSymfonyEventDispatcherの実装

SymfonyEventDispatcherは、デザインパターンの一種であるObserverパターンで実装されたライブラリです。 symfonyではこのライブラリを介してフレームワーク内の様々な処理を行っています。 Observerパターン SymfonyEventDispatcherを理解する上で前提とな…

24日に24歳になるので

ひとつの区切りとして、この1年の振り返りなどしてみようと思います。 23歳のわたし 出会いの年 この1年間を一言で表すと、「出会いの年」でした。 PHPとかのコミュニティに顔を出すようになったのはちょうど1年半くらい前なのですが、それまではホントに仕…

sotarokを勝手に祝う会を全力で開催した

なんというか、燃え尽きて(?)眠れないので忘れないうちに書いておこう。 無事「sotarokを勝手に祝う会」を開催することができました。 今考えると、思いついてから2週間でよくここまでできたなと。 開催日時が某Waveの追悼式と被ったり、調子に乗りすぎ…

sotarokを勝手に祝う会を開催します

PHP界の次期キング・オブ・HIPHOPと噂されるid:sotarokがこのたび結婚いたしました。あまりにめでたいのでsotarokを勝手に祝う会を開催します。 ■■■ sotarok を勝手に祝う会 ■■■ * 2010/8/21 (土) 18:00〜20:30 (17:30 受付開始) * 東京都港区六本木5-16-50 …

LLTigerでドラ娘業

2010/07/31(土)に開催されたLLTigerでドラ娘をさせていただきました。 このイベントはLightweightな言語についての総合カンファレンスで、 2003年から毎年行われているものです。 毎度のことながら会場にたどり着くまでにかなり迷ってしまって 朝から泣きそ…

symfony1.4でdoctrineのコマンド叩いたときのエラー

symfony1.4でdoctrineのコマンド叩いたときに出たエラーの解消法をメモ。 PHP Warning: PDO::__construct(): [2002] No such file or directory (trying to connect via unix:///var/mysql/mysql.sock) in /Applications/symfony-1.4.1/lib/plugins/sfDoctri…

keccon2010に参加&LTしてきた

7月3日に開催された、keccon2010に参加してきました。 ※keccon2010は、id:Yoshioriさんとid:ngtykさんの結婚を記念して開かれたカンファレンスです。 最初から最後まで幸せな空気につつまれたイベントで、すごく心が温まりました(´∀`) ご夫婦に直接お会い…

開発合宿してきた

2010/05/04-05にかけて、nequalメンバで開発合宿をしてきました。 場所はアシアル株式会社様。 丸二日間も会議室貸し切りという無茶な条件でしたが、無料で貸し出してくださいました。素敵すぎます>< 参加者は7人。 それぞれ開発したり執筆したり思い思い…

六〇〇万人の女性に支持される「クックパッド」というビジネス

「六〇〇万人の女性に支持される「クックパッド」というビジネス」を読みました。 私自身クックパッドはヘビーユーザで、夕飯のメニュー決めるときとか かなりお世話になってます。 中身がRuby on Railsで作られているというのは有名な話ですが、 Rubyを使っ…

Ruby検定受かった(´∀`)

実質1週間も勉強できてないけど86点で合格しました(合格ラインは75点) せっかくなのでどんな勉強したかメモっておこうと思う。(えらそうに ちなみにほぼRuby書いたことない状態からのスタートでした。 使った書籍は一つだけ。 勉強方法 1.文法とか機…

Ruby検定受けることにした

やっぱり島根県民としてはRubyを嗜んでおくべきだよね、ということで 今月中に受けることにしました。(会社でも流行ってるしw とりあえずお家での勉強のためにRubyインストール☆ cd $HOME/local/src wget ftp://ftp.ruby-lang.org/pub/ruby/1.9/ruby-1.9.1…

第50回PHP勉強会に参加してきた

symfony1.4勉強会のレポートと前後してすみません・・・ 02/22(土)に開催された、第50回PHP勉強会に参加してきました。 今回も、前回に引き続き株式会社コンテンツワンさんに会場をお借りしての開催。 記念すべき50回目の勉強会ということで、スピーカーの方…

symfony1.4勉強会に行ってきた

2月25日(木)に株式会社ファーストロジック様で開催されたsymfony1.4勉強会に行ってきました。内容的には、symfonyの紹介から入門的なチュートリアル、サイト構築の実例紹介などでした。トピック順に紹介していきます。 symfonyの歴史 バージョン特徴 1.0リ…

NetBeansでsymfonyプロジェクト作るまで

MacでNetBeansをインストールしてからsymfonyプロジェクト作るまでの手順。10分とかでできたーっ超カンタン! 1. PHPの実行環境用意しとく(xamppとかでおk) 2. NetBeans6.8をダウンロード/適当な場所に解凍 http://netbeans.org/downloads/index.html?p…

第49回PHP勉強会に参加してきた

01/30(土)に開催された、第49回PHP勉強会に参加してきました。 今回は株式会社コンテンツワンさんに会場をお借りしての開催。 発表された順で紹介して行きます。 Lithiumラボ #1 超先進的フレームワーク yandoさん Ceke3から派生したフレームワークLithium…

Macでprintscreen

Macでのprintscreenの方法をメモ。 画面全体をキャプチャ Shiftキー + Commandキー + 3 ウィンドウを指定してキャプチャ Shiftキー + Commandキー + 4 + Space →カーソルがカメラのアイコンになるので、キャプチャしたいウィンドウ上でクリック 範囲指定して…

EclipseとNetBeansはどっちがかわゆいのか

IDEってEclipseしか使ったことないのですが、先日id:yandodさんからこんな記事を教えてもらってちょっとだけNetBeansに興味がわいてきた。http://blogs.sun.com/netbeansphp/entry/symfony_support_screencast symfony対応とかすてきすぐる!!!! というわ…

ソフトウェア開発で伸びる人、伸びない人

【ソフトウェア開発で伸びる人、伸びない人】という本を読んだ。同じ環境で仕事をしていても、考え方や仕事の仕方によって成長するかしないか全然違ってくる、という内容だった。まずこの本を読んで思ったのは、1、2年前までの私は確実に「伸びない人」だ…

2010年目標

2010年の目標はアウトプット。 去年は色々吸収することでいっぱいいっぱいだったので、 今年はちゃんと得たものを外に出すことをしたいと思う。 "Give back as much as you take.", "Pay it Forward."の精神で。 具体的には 1.イベントに参加したら必ずエン…